		<description><![CDATA[This high powered LED par projector makes use of the latest in LED technology with 18 x 3w TRI colour LED’s. These Tri LEDs incorporate three colours in each LED providing smoother colour mixing and removing much of the multi shadow normally associated with standard LED wash lights.
